Purpose of Repayment Bonds



If you wish to recognize the relevance of repayment bonds, you have to initially understand their key objective in building projects. Settlement bonds act as an essential defense device for subcontractors and vendors. In the world of construction, these events frequently deal with repayment concerns because of numerous reasons, such as service provider personal bankruptcy or economic instability. Payment bonds act as a guarantee that subcontractors and providers will certainly receive repayment for their job and products, even if the contractor defaults.

By calling for repayment bonds on jobs, job owners make certain that all events associated with the construction process are financially protected. This requirement provides assurance to subcontractors and providers, urging them to join jobs without the concern of non-payment. Furthermore, settlement bonds assist preserve a smooth flow of work with the construction site by lessening disruptions caused by payment disagreements.



Recognizing the function of payment bonds is crucial for all stakeholders in construction tasks. It makes certain reasonable compensation for subcontractors and providers, advertises job security, and enhances total task performance.

Exactly How Settlement Bonds Are Acquired



To obtain payment bonds for building and construction projects, specialists generally approach guaranty business that specialize in giving these financial assurances. Guaranty business evaluate the contractor's economic security, credit reliability, and job background prior to issuing a repayment bond. The contractor should finish an application process that consists of submitting economic documents and project details for assessment.

As soon as the surety business accepts the application, the contractor pays a premium for the bond based on the project's complete worth and the specialist's danger account. The settlement bond serves as an economic assurance that subcontractors and vendors will certainly be paid for their work and materials. It additionally supplies peace of mind to job owners that the specialist has the financial backing to finish the job successfully.

Technicians of Repayment Bonds



Understanding the auto mechanics of repayment bonds is crucial for navigating the intricacies of construction project funding. Repayment bonds are a three-party contract among the project proprietor, the specialist, and the guaranty company. Once a professional is granted a job, they commonly acquire a settlement bond to make certain that subcontractors, laborers, and vendors are spent for their job and materials. In the event that the contractor falls short to fulfill settlement obligations, the repayment bond is in location to provide a source of funds for these parties.

When a subcontractor or supplier goes unpaid, they can make a case against the repayment bond. The procedure involves submitting a created notification to the guaranty business describing the quantity owed and providing any kind of needed paperwork. The surety after that explores the case to establish its credibility. If the claim is authorized, the surety will certainly make payment to the plaintiff, as much as the bond amount.

Comprehending these technicians is necessary for all events associated with a building job to make sure appropriate repayment techniques and monetary security.
